Biography
Giovanni is an experienced geophysicist with project management background.
His expertise includes processing and interpretation of geological and geophysical data, 3D modelling & inversion and large data management for mineral exploration, resource evaluation and targeting.
Giovanni has completed a PhD at Monash University that contributed to a better understanding of plate architecture and evolution of the transition between Proterozoic Australia and the eastern margin of Gondwana, with a focus on the southern Mount Isa terrane and the central Thomson Orogen in Queensland.
Before joining CSIRO, Giovanni has worked as a senior geoscientist and 3D modeler at the Geological Survey of NSW, building 3D geological and structural models of tectonic provinces, basins and sites of interest.
Giovanni’s focus is on stimulating the development of Australia’s mineral and petroleum wealth and promoting cost effective exploration and discovery of the next mineral deposit undercover through advances in technologies, resource characterisation and data analysis.
His current role at CSIRO will contribute to create new knowledge and methods in the field of 3D geological modelling through an integrated approach, develop new technologies to mitigate 3D geological risk in resources management and support industry priorities of the CSIRO discovery programs Exploration Through Cover and Orebody Knowledge.

Other highlights
-
2011-2014
Unveiling the crustal architecture and tectonic evolution of the southern Mount Isa terrane and the Thomson Orogen in Queensland, proposing a mechanism for the evolution of the transition between Proterozoic Australia and the eastern margin of Gondwana.
-
2016-2016
Working on structural interpretation, 3D modelling and geophysical inversion in Oyu Tolgoi (Mongolia), Greenstone Belts (Western Australia) and Dinaric Alps (Southcentral Europe).
-
2017-2018
Building a state-wide 3D fault model and updating the basement elevation model for NSW through an integrated approach using all available geological and geophysical data.
-
2019-2020
Building a 3D geotechnical model for the Western Sydney Airport as a proof of concept. Volume estimations were exact, proving that 3D modelling can be a great tool for earthworks and foundation design.
